Skip to content

Commit 071e821

Browse files
committed
FIX: clone object to resolve object mutation bug during autocomplete transform in chat
1 parent c95b9c2 commit 071e821

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

plugins/chat/assets/javascripts/discourse/components/chat-composer.gjs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-482,7 +482,7 @@ export default class ChatComposer extends Component {
482482
autoSelectFirstSuggestion: true,
483483
transformComplete: (obj) => {
484484
if (obj.isUser) {
485-
this.#addMentionedUser(obj);
485+
this.#addMentionedUser(cloneJSON(obj));
486486
}
487487

488488
return obj.username || obj.name;

0 commit comments

Comments
 (0)